  • Personally own and execute product deliverables across multiple digital-asset work streams, including requirements, functional and technical documentation, user stories, and acceptance criteria
  • Serve as a key day-to-day contact for clients, internal partners, and cross-functional stakeholders, maintaining productive relationships and clear communication regarding progress, changes, timelines, and decisions
  • Coordinate activity across Product, Technology, Architecture, Operations, Risk, Legal, and Compliance to maintain alignment and momentum across connected work streams
  • Manage the intake of incoming requests, questions, and escalations, ensuring that each has a clear owner, response path, priority, and target date
  • Monitor progress across work streams and maintain disciplined follow-through on open items, dependencies, approvals, and commitments
  • Maintain a consolidated, current view of product status, risks, decisions, dependencies, and implementation readiness
  • Provide the Product Director with timely, decision-ready updates, highlighting matters that require leadership awareness, input, or escalation
  • Identify emerging risks, requirements gaps, and competing priorities early, and recommend practical options and next steps
